Standard 50m netting comes with built-in posts making it easy to erect and move. Electric netting is commonly used by livestock owners to secure free-ranging chickens on pastures including other farm animals like sheep, pigs and goats. Depending on the area to be covered you could either use 2 separate electric fence systems or create a continuous fence line - whichever is the most suitable. Tread-in plastic posts are not sturdy enough for corners so use a 1” fiberglass corner post or a wooden post with wood post insulators.Įlectric Netting is ideal to create pens (perhaps at lambing time) if needed or for straight line fencing for strip grazing. To create a controlled pasture management system, you may require both a fence 'in-front of' and 'behind the flock'. If your overall fence is going to exceed more than 400m be use to use a low resistance poly wire, twines or braids to ensure you have and effective shock over longer distances. Sheep with a full fleece are very well insulated which can make them more difficult to shock, so taking both thickness of fleece and distance of the fence into account it is essential to ensure the energizer is sufficiently powerful enough to deliver an effective shock especially for initial training.
